Friday, December 2, 2011 - Bill's Monthly Lunch - December 2011 (Vancouver, BC): Tasted blind – medium to deep red. This at first had that vitamin casing smell but thankfully it blew off leaving notes of sweet dark red fruits, tobacco and plums. This nose was Bordeaux-ish, but not quite. In the mouth this is quite silky with red fruits, firm tannins and good acidity. Very-well balanced. Once it was revealed as ’96 Dominus it became clear as this ’96 typically isn’t as claret-like as other vintages of Dominus can be (’91 and ’94 come to mind). This ’96 is drinking well but I think it should improve with another few years in the cellar. Very good. 89+
